Education Minister Says Fewer Nigerian Students Are Leaving to Study Abroad

Tori | 13-05-2026 08:57pm |

The Nigerian Minister of Education, Tunji Alausa, has addressed concerns regarding the trend of students pursuing education overseas, stating that there has been a notable decrease in the number of Nigerian students seeking to study abroad. He emphasized that this decline is a result of the current administration's efforts to improve the quality of education within the country. Alausa's remarks come amid ongoing discussions about the challenges facing the Nigerian education system and the appeal of foreign institutions. The Minister's comments aim to reassure stakeholders about the government's commitment to enhancing local educational opportunities.
